The Campidoglio Fountain

Should you go to the Piazza del Campidoglio in Rome you can find three fountains of interest. On this imposing square, these fountains Each individual have a particularly intriguing background. They haven’t really been in position in their current setting for that prolonged but Each and every fountain has had a abundant and assorted history. Actually, the sculptures you’ll see on these three fountains is often traced again to the early days of Christian Rome.

The very first on the a few fountains that you simply’ll most likely detect inside the piazza could be the central fountain that leads up towards the magnificent Palace of your Senators. Though initially planned by Michelangelo when he laid out types for that piazza, the fountain was only made in the reign of Sixtus V who diverted a water source with the Acqua Felice that would then offer a fountain. Initial strategies experienced decreed that this fountain would comprise the determine of Jove as its centerpiece, as a substitute it had been built across the determine of Minerva who stands since the figurehead of Rome. Minerva’s statue has partly been restored in contemporary moments though the torso was brought to Rome from Cori so it is really of great historic importance.

In front of the Minerva fountain you’ll look for a fountain decorated with the sculptures of two river gods. These statues are actually of important historical desire; contrary to many lost treasures they may have survived without the need of burial in all the turbulent periods due to the fact Rome’s downfall. Originally they were being located in front of Aurelian’s Temple with the Solar and they've considering the fact that moved all around many settings in Rome ahead of settling inside their present-day location. Much like the Palace of your Senators prior to which they stand, Considerably of this fountain is constructed of travertine which fountain genuinely does meld to the magnificent constructing seamlessly.

You’ll find the third fountain inside the Piazza del Campidoglio within the gardens of the Palazzo dei Conservatori. This fountain has hardly earned its name since it is actually additional of the basin using an unconventional sculpture attached. The sculpture, which was extra to the square in 1903, displays a lion feasting with a horse that it's got hunted down. Though this fountain might not appear sizeable the sculpture by itself is of authentic historical import. For those who look intently at the lion you’ll note that it seems to indicate get more info the effects of getting subjected to drinking water for prolonged periods. It absolutely was basically found out during the River Almo more than a thousand a long time back While its background prior to That continues to be a secret.
